CANON CITY, Colo. -- Patrick Frazee, the man convicted of killing his former fiancee, Kelsey Berreth, has been moved to a maximum security facility in Fremont County.

Frazee is currently being held at the Colorado State Penitentiary, according to the Colorado Department of Corrections.

Frazee was convicted of first degree murder and sentenced to life in prison in November.

He was transferred from the Teller County Jail on Dec. 11.
